WebDec 2, 2024 · But, if you are currently unable to pay your taxes, please contact SARS without delay. The following options may be available to you: 1. Payment arrangements: Under certain circumstances SARS can reach an agreement with a taxpayer to defer a tax debt for later payment or for payment by instalments. WebJan 23, 2015 · Through an instalment payment agreement, a senior SARS official may, again at his/her discretion, allow you to pay the outstanding tax debt in either a series of instalments or in one some but only after a period of time (when your business starts picking up …

WebPaying instalments. Generally, corporations have to pay their taxes in instalments. An instalment payment is a partial payment of the total amount of tax payable for the year. The Income Tax Act requires corporations to make instalment payments so that they are treated the same as taxpayers who have tax deducted from their income at source. WebJul 28, 2016 · In this situation, avoidance is the worst strategy you can embark upon. The first step you need to take is to make contact with SARS without delay, either via their contact centre on 0800 00 SARS (7277) or by visiting your nearest branch. Like any creditor, the key is communication; by communicating clearly and discussing your financial ...
